Efficient SCM involves optimizing logistics, inventory management, and supplier relationships to minimize material costs, reduce lead times, and enhance overall operational efficiency. By sourcing materials strategically, negotiating favorable terms with suppliers, and implementing just-in-time (JIT) inventory systems, businesses can mitigate supply chain risks and control costs effectively. Overhead costs, such as rent, utilities, equipment depreciation, and maintenance, are necessary to keep your production facility running smoothly. However, these expenses are often incurred for the entire facility, making it challenging to attribute them to individual products.
